Medjedovic vs. Mensik matchup performance & stats
- In 11 tournaments on hard courts over the past year, Medjedovic has gone 11-12.
- In terms of serve/return winning percentages on hard courts over the past 12 months, Medjedovic has won 77.9% of his games on serve and 24.3% on return.
- Including hard courts only, Medjedovic has converted 40.7% of his break-point opportunities (44 of 108) over the past 12 months.
- In his most recent tournament, the Rolex Shanghai Masters, Medjedovic went down in a round of 128 to No. 54-ranked Arthur Rinderknech, 7-6, 0-1 (retired) on October 2.
- Mensik has gone 16-10 in 11 tournaments on hard courts over the past 12 months, and he has won one title.
- Mensik has 253 wins in 315 service games when playing on hard courts (80.3%), and 77 wins in 316 return games (24.4%).
- Mensik has won 38.3% of break points on hard courts (59 out of 154) which ranks 59th.
- In his last tournament (the Rolex Shanghai Masters) on October 4, Mensik matched up with Jesper de Jong in the Round of 64 and was defeated 6-4, 6-7, 4-6.
